This method uses the correlation between a launched pseudorandom noise code signal and its reflection enabling simultaneous measurement at many points along the optical fiber in real time with a high signal-to-noise ratio. In a light intensity-based experiment with an 850-nm LED, the tested three hetero-core optical fiber hydrogen tip sensors proved to be reproducible responses with and without hydrogen absorption, with showing the similar time response and sensitivity compared with those of our previously reported sensor. Multipoint hydrogen detection was demonstrated using four SPR hydrogen tip sensors. Our experimental results showed that four sensors using the 25 nm Au/60 nm Ta2O5/5 nm Pd multilayer film exhibited a response time of ~ 25 s for a 4% hydrogen concentration.
